Box transformers (also known as compact substations) are essential components in electrical distribution networks, serving to step down high-voltage electricity to levels that can be safely used by end-users. Transformers generate heat during normal operation, but excessive heat buildup can lead to a range of issues, including insulation breakdown and reduced efficiency. Determining the best installation angle for a photovoltaic (PV) bracket is a critical step in maximizing the energy output of a solar power system. If the angle is too flat, the panels might not get enough direct sunlight, especially during the winter when the sun is lower in the sky. Panels positioned perpendicular to the sun's rays absorb maximum energy, but the sun's position changes with seasons and your geographic location.
